SMBJ4740E3/TR13
Product Overview
- Category: Diode
- Use: Voltage suppression in electronic circuits
- Characteristics: Transient voltage suppressor diode, 600W peak pulse power capability, low clamping voltage, fast response time
- Package: DO-214AA (SMB), 2.9mm height
- Essence: Provides protection against voltage transients
- Packaging/Quantity: Tape & Reel, 3000 units per reel
Specifications
- Peak Power Dissipation: 600W
- Breakdown Voltage Range: 43.6V to 51.4V
- Operating Temperature Range: -55°C to +150°C
- Reverse Standoff Voltage: 40V
- Forward Voltage: 3.5V at 10A

Working Principles
The SMBJ4740E3/TR13 operates by diverting excess current away from sensitive components when a transient voltage spike occurs. It acts as a shunt to protect downstream electronics from overvoltage events.
